个人博客使用WordPress,2核2G服务器够用吗?

对于个人博客使用 WordPress,2核2G 的服务器在大多数情况下是够用的,但需满足一定前提条件,并建议合理优化。以下是详细分析和实用建议:

够用的前提(典型场景):

  • 博客为纯内容型(文章为主,少量图片,无视频/大附件)
  • 日均独立访客(UV)≤ 500~1000,峰值并发 ≤ 30~50(如普通访问、搜索引擎爬虫、少量社交分享)
  • 使用轻量级主题(如 Astra、GeneratePress、Neve)+ 少量必要插件(≤ 15个,不含重型插件如全站缓存+CDN+安全+SEO+表单+电商等)
  • 启用了有效的缓存机制(推荐 WP Super Cache / LiteSpeed Cache + OPcache + 浏览器缓存)
  • 数据库优化良好(定期清理修订版本、垃圾评论、临时数据)

⚠️ 可能不够用或易卡顿的情况:

  • 安装了多个“全能型”插件(如 Wordfence 全功能版 + Jetpack 全模块 + Yoast SEO + WP Rocket + WooCommerce + 备份插件定时运行)
  • 启用实时监控、暴力破解防护(如 Fail2ban 配置不当)、或未优化的 XML-RPC
  • 图片未压缩/未使用 WebP + 未启用 CDN → 大量静态资源直连服务器
  • MySQL 默认配置未调优(如 innodb_buffer_pool_size 过小,导致频繁磁盘 I/O)
  • 开启了 PHP 调试模式、Xdebug 或错误日志级别过高
  • 有定时任务(wp-cron)过于密集(如每分钟检查 RSS、同步第三方 API)
🔧 关键优化建议(让 2核2G 发挥最大效能): 类别 推荐方案
Web 服务器 ✅ 用 OpenLiteSpeed(比 Nginx/Apache 更省内存)或精简 Nginx + PHP-FPM(pm = ondemand, pm.max_children = 20
PHP ✅ PHP 8.1+(性能更好、内存更少),禁用不必要扩展;启用 OPcache(opcache.enable=1, opcache.memory_consumption=128
数据库 ✅ MySQL 8.0+ 或 MariaDB 10.6+;调整 innodb_buffer_pool_size = 512M~768M(占内存 1/3~1/2);定期优化表、禁用 log_bin(非主从环境)
WordPress ✅ 关闭修订版本:define('WP_POST_REVISIONS', 3);;禁用自动保存:define('AUTOSAVE_INTERVAL', 300);;用 WP-Optimize 清理数据库
缓存层 ✅ 必选:页面缓存(LiteSpeed Cache 或 WP Super Cache)+ 对象缓存(Redis,仅需 64MB 内存,大幅提升数据库压力)
CDN ✅ 推荐 Cloudflare 免费版(静态资源提速 + DDoS 基础防护 + 自动 HTTPS)
监控 ✅ 用 htop / mysqltuner / wp doctor 定期检查瓶颈;避免用后台插件实时监控(耗资源)

📈 性能参考(实测经验):

  • 优化后的 2核2G(CentOS 8 + OpenLiteSpeed + Redis + LiteSpeed Cache)可稳定支撑:
    • ✅ 日均 UV 1500+(含 30% 移动端 + 搜索引擎爬虫)
    • ✅ 页面平均加载 < 0.8s(首屏,CDN 后)
    • ✅ 服务器内存常驻 1.1~1.4G,CPU 峰值 < 60%

💡 进阶建议(低成本升级路径):

  • 若流量持续增长(>2000 UV/天)或计划加功能(如会员系统、邮件订阅、轻量 API),可:
    • 升级到 2核4G(价格通常只高 30~50%,内存翻倍极大缓解 PHP/MySQL 压力)
    • 或迁移到 轻量应用服务器(如腾讯云轻量、阿里云共享型)+ 对象存储 COS/OSS 存图片/附件

✅ 总结:
2核2G ≠ 不够用,而是“需要认真优化”。它非常适合起步阶段的个人技术博客、写作博客、作品集展示。只要避开常见陷阱(如插件滥用、无缓存、图片直传),完全可以长期稳定运行。

如需,我可以为你提供一份 2核2G 专属的 WordPress 优化 checklist(含具体配置命令和 wp-config.php 片段),欢迎随时告诉我 😊

是否需要?

未经允许不得转载:CLOUD云枢 » 个人博客使用WordPress,2核2G服务器够用吗?